~ THE BYAKKO KINGDOM SPLASHED OUT THEIR MONEY THIS WEEK !
The General Manager, Number Twenty Three, spent almost 1M$ in less than a week. A record !

According to the club's website, the General Manager (Editor's note : Number Twenty Three) invest a lot amount of money on the improvement of his franchise. Indeed, after spending 200k$ on the expansion of the West Constellation Arena, offering to the fans 100 new court-side seats, N#23 ended this week with the signing of an aggressive player -- Miles Buckley (6194246) -- for $ 734 400.
Number Twenty Three describe the player as very athletic that can easily find the best position shot. "In order to prepare the Play-Offs, the team needed some reinforcement. The staff is very enthusiast on the chances to create something special this year. After the disillusion of last years Play-Off performance (Editor's note : the BKs lost their first and last game against the Sunemeang Dragons), the staff wanted to make the effort to do the best as they can in order to avoid any form of regrets. And I love this way of thinking, it fits with my personality. I already feel like home", claimed Miles Buckley on his presentation press conference. Let's see what the future reserves to the "freshByakko" (Editor's note : it is the name given to the new players in the Byakko Kingdom roster).

~ SHOCK IN PERCEPTIVE !
Leader Vs. Leader. The next League II.1 championship game promise to be explosive !

Undefeated. That's how Hover Breave (59353) incontestable leader of the Big 8 will aboard their next championship game against the Byakko Kingdom (13 Wins, 1 Lost) leader of the Great 8. For specialists, this game looks like the future Play-Off finals of this League. Currently, Cute Duke -- General Manager of Hover Breave -- have the upper hand on N#23 thanks to his League I.1 experience. But with an interesting recruitment done these past weeks and an efficient training program, the Byakko Kingdom may have their word to say. First act : tommorow @t the Micky Center.

~ HOVER BREAVE (H)OVER THE LEAGUE.
After defeating all the teams listed in League II.1, Hover Breave rules on the current championship !

15 - 0. That's the report of Hover Breave sportive result since the beginning of BuzzerBeater's Season 13. With an impressive $ 178 933/weekly salary roster, how could it be different ? Balanced in all sectors of the game (Inside & Outside). Dangerous in attack as well as in defense, Cute Duck is about to carry out successfully its objective : promoting in League I.1 after a relegation. But even though the general manager has all the reasons the be confident, contenders didn't say there last words as they're training hard in order to titillate the final victory.
